Opened 13 years ago

Closed 12 years ago

#75 closed defect/bug (fixed)

The voice message "Turn right/left NOW" comes too late

Reported by: hafting Owned by: somebody
Priority: major Milestone: version 0.2.0
Component: core Version:
Severity: Keywords:
Cc:

Description

A navit conversation typically goes like this: "Turn left soon" "Turn left in 200 m" "Turn left now"

("Soon" is wrong when driving in a city - "turn left in a while" is what it feels like.") But that is just words.

The real problem is timing. I usually get the "turn left now" message in the middle of the intersection, I am already making the turn.

The message needs to come earlier, so the driver have time to react. Plus some time to make up for gps inaccuracy (and similiar map inaccuracy. Perhaps map inaccuracy needs to be a parameter in the xml file. Those with a good map don't want the messages too early, those with a bad map don't want to be told what turn they just missed half the time.)

The driver needs time to hear the entire message+reaction time. Message time vary with language, but perhaps it can be tested by timing the messages during compile? Message distance can then be computed from current speed.

Then there is the reaction time. The driver may need to brake from high speed, especially if it is a hard turn. Motorways usually don't need braking before the turn, but a good map should show the turn as a slow turn and tag the road as motorway anyway.

Change History (2)

comment:1 Changed 13 years ago by KaZeR

  • Milestone set to version 0.0.4

comment:2 Changed 12 years ago by Tinloaf

  • Resolution set to fixed
  • Status changed from new to closed

This should actually have been fixed when we changed the navigation.

Note: See TracTickets for help on using tickets.